Volkswagen Revives International Scout as US-Built EV Truck and SUV

Posted on May 12, 2022August 27, 2023 By bot

It’s been 42 years since the last International Harvester Scout rolled off the line, having first debuted in 1961 as a pioneering SUV. Now Volkswagen, of all brands, is resurrecting Scout as its own separate brand of electric vehicles that will be built in the US. We first heard rumors of the Scout revival last year, but on Wednesday the brand confirmed the announcement with a teaser image showing off Scout’s two upcoming models.
